Passaic County Released Inmates and Bergen Jail

At the end of 2021, Passaic County moved its inmates to the Bergen County Jail through a shared services agreement. Bergen County gets paid $104 per day for each Passaic County inmate it holds. Up to 700 inmates were part of this transfer. This change means that released inmates from Passaic County may have their most recent records tied to the Bergen County facility. The original Passaic County Jail sits at 11 Marshall Street in Paterson, NJ 07501. It was first built in 1957 with 227 beds. Over time, it grew to hold 1,242 people across four floors.

Bergen County also has a deal with Hudson County for female inmates. Women from Passaic County who are in custody may be housed at a different site. This matters when you search for released inmates. The name might not show up in the Passaic County system alone. You may need to check Bergen or Hudson County records too.

The Passaic County Sheriff's Office still oversees law enforcement and court duties from 435 Hamburg Turnpike in Wayne, NJ 07470. You can call them at 973-389-5900 for questions about released inmates or case status.

Released Inmates Lookup in Passaic County

The Passaic County inmate search tool lets you look up who is or was held in the county jail. You can search by first name, last name, or a unique identifier. The tool pulls from the Passaic County booking system. It shows current and past inmates. When someone is released, their record stays in the database. This makes it a strong source for released inmates data in Passaic County.

Passaic County Jail Visitation Rules

Visiting an inmate in Passaic County follows a set schedule. Personal visits happen on Tuesday through Thursday from 12 PM to 2:30 PM and again from 5 PM to 10 PM. On Saturday and Sunday, visits run from 9 AM to 2:30 PM and 5 PM to 10 PM. Monday and Friday only allow evening visits from 5 PM to 10 PM. Attorney visits are open every day from 8 AM to 10 AM, 12 PM to 2 PM, and 5:30 PM to 10 PM. For same day attorney visits, call 862-239-7089.

Passaic County Records and State Tools

Some released inmates from Passaic County go on to state prison or parole. The New Jersey DOC inmate finder tracks people held in state facilities. If someone left the Passaic County Jail and was sent to a state prison, their record will appear in this system. It shows custody status, location, and release dates for state inmates.

For people on parole, the NJ parole offender search can help you find their status after leaving Passaic County. Parole records are separate from jail records. Both are useful when tracking released inmates in New Jersey.

A 2010 upgrade to the Passaic County Jail added new HVAC, plumbing, and electrical systems. Fire alarms, security features, and video cameras were all replaced. These updates made the facility safer for staff and inmates during the years it was in full use in Passaic County.

Public Records for Passaic County Inmates

New Jersey's Open Public Records Act lets you request released inmates records from Passaic County. Under OPRA, the county must respond within seven business days. Most booking logs, release dates, and charge data are public. Items like medical files and Social Security numbers are not shared. You can file a request through the OPRA Central portal.

Released inmates records that are public in Passaic County typically include the person's full name, booking date, charges, bail amount, and release date. If your request is turned down, the Government Records Council handles appeals at no cost. This gives you a path to get Passaic County released inmates data even if the first request does not go through.

Released Inmates and Court Cases

Court records connect to released inmates in Passaic County. A person may be out of jail but still have an open case. The New Jersey Courts case search lets you find criminal cases by name or docket number. It shows hearing dates, charges, and case outcomes. This is helpful when you need more than just the release date for someone held in Passaic County.

The Superior Court in Paterson handles all criminal cases for Passaic County. Released inmates often have pending court dates. Bail conditions and sentencing details appear in the court docket. Checking both jail and court records gives you the full picture for any released inmates case in Passaic County.

You can also use VINE to track custody changes and get alerts when someone is released from any New Jersey jail.
